Frequently Asked Questions about Parker
What type of rentals are currently available in Parker?
There are currently 52 Apartments for Rent in Parker, TX with pricing that ranges from $1,016 to $13,770. There are also 141 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Parker ranging from $1,750 to $12,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Parker?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Parker ranges from $1,750 to $12,500 with an average monthly rent of $4,893.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Parker?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Parker range from $1,742 to $10,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,795 to $4,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,899 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,250.
